Summer internships in a station close to dwelling are merely as worthwhile and don?�t conflict having a college student?�s university timetable and scientific studies.|By negotiating exclusive Olympic protection offers and airing significant sporting events, NBC swiftly set up alone as the industry leader by putting TV viewership and rankings very first. Sports took up 27½ hours of primetime programming every week by 1948, demonstrating their affordability in comparison with scripted programming. The connection concerning sports as well as the media was strengthened when advertisers realised how successful sports ended up at reaching goal audiences (Collins, 2015).|Circling again as we have been taking a further dive into the faculty lookup considering that I emailed past. Let me understand what you think that of those faculties, and In case you have almost every other tips (Preferably from the Northeast):|The debut of ESPN in 1979 revolutionized the broadcasting of sports gatherings. In just quite a few years of ESPN's founding as a basic cable channel, it experienced made a secure of sports broadcasts starting from key leagues to oddities. ESPN has considering that grown into a massive multiplexed network, with quite a few channels and a significant information bureau which has led for the network bestowing the title of "Worldwide Chief in Sports" on by itself. Cable, and later electronic cable and satellite, considerably expanded the quantity of channels (and, by extension, the area for broadcasting sports occasions) readily available over a presented set, in addition to gave channels for instance ESPN the opportunity to broadcast direct and nationwide, instead of coping with area affiliate marketers.|Wow ??your son is accepted to some magnificent packages!!
